The Role of Butyl Rubber Windshield Sealant in Automotive Applications


When it comes to automotive manufacturing and repair, the importance of maintaining a secure and moisture-resistant seal around the windshield cannot be overstated. One of the most popular materials used for this purpose is butyl rubber sealant. Known for its exceptional adhesion properties, flexibility, and longevity, butyl rubber has become a staple in the automotive industry, particularly for windshield installations.


What is Butyl Rubber?


Butyl rubber is a synthetic rubber that is primarily composed of isobutylene and isoprene. Its unique chemical structure provides it with remarkable properties such as excellent airtightness, resistance to weathering, and superior adhesion. These characteristics make butyl rubber an ideal choice for sealing applications, especially in automobiles where protection from the elements is critical.


Key Benefits of Butyl Rubber Windshield Sealant


1. Waterproof and Airtight Seal One of the primary functions of butyl rubber sealant is to create a waterproof seal around the windshield. This prevents water from leaking into the vehicle's cabin, which can lead to mold growth, electrical issues, and structural damage over time. The airtight properties of butyl rubber also contribute to a quieter cabin by minimizing wind noise.

2. Flexibility and Durability The flexibility of butyl rubber allows it to accommodate the natural expansion and contraction of materials in response to temperature changes. This is especially important in automotive applications, where vehicles are exposed to varying climates. Butyl rubber maintains its integrity over time, ensuring that the seal remains effective for many years, even under harsh conditions.


3. Excellent Adhesion Butyl rubber sealant bonds exceptionally well to glass and metal surfaces, making it ideal for securing windshields in place. This strong bond is essential to the structural integrity of the vehicle, as the windshield also serves as a critical safety feature. In the event of a collision, a properly bonded windshield can help support the vehicle's structure and protect occupants.


4. Resistance to Environmental Factors Butyl rubber is highly resistant to ultraviolet (UV) light, ozone, and temperature fluctuations, which can degrade other types of sealants. This resistance extends the lifespan of the seal, reducing the need for frequent maintenance or replacement. Additionally, its chemical stability ensures that it won’t break down or release harmful substances into the environment.


5. Easy Application Butyl rubber sealants are available in various forms, including tapes, caulks, and liquid adhesives. This variety makes it easy for automotive technicians to apply the product in a way that best suits the specific requirements of each vehicle's windshield installation. The easy application process also contributes to faster repair times, minimizing downtime for vehicles.
